## 📦 Install JekyllUp
### Option 1: Install via npm
Install with npm if you plan to use `jekyllup` in a Node project or in the browser.
```shell
npm install jekyllup
```
If you plan to use `jekyllup` in a browser environment, you will probably need to use [Webpack](https://www.npmjs.com/package/webpack), [Browserify](https://www.npmjs.com/package/browserify), or a similar service to compile it.

```js
const jekyllup = new (require('jekyllup'))({
  // Not required, but having one removes limits (get your key at https://jekyllup.com).
  apiKey: 'api_test_key'
});
```

### Option 2: Install via CDN
Install with CDN if you plan to use JekyllUp only in a browser environment.
```html
<script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/jekyllup@latest/dist/index.min.js"></script>
<script type="text/javascript">
  var jekyllup = new JekyllUp({
    // Not required, but having one removes limits (get your key at https://jekyllup.com).
    apiKey: 'api_test_Key'
  });
</script>
```

### Option 3: Use without installation
You can use `jekyllup` in a variety of ways that require no installation, such as `curl` in terminal/shell.

```shell
# Standard
curl -X POST https://api.jekyllup.com
```
